Transaction dc49a5180fc2067a0751480c81e23315946ae8c8944a95363480abd043b0536c
2 Input
2 Outputs
- dc49a5180fc2067a0751480c81e23315946ae8c8944a95363480abd043b0536c:0
- dc49a5180fc2067a0751480c81e23315946ae8c8944a95363480abd043b0536c:1
value 418400
address 1DUCEhiD2ZmQjrfTSD7h1nfmfdGsbC7SLy
value 1434000
address 3CX2Ff1S4GKHe8mmPUMrCoL6iGeUgua4AW